Bana Trust

Core Activities:

    To support the setting up and running of care units for street children in Lesotho.

    To assist and provide benefits for orphans and abandoned children in Lesotho.

Activities in Lesotho:

Feeding: provision of fruit, bread, cheese and meat to 15-20 street boys.

Education: providing uniforms for 5 OVC.

Economic Strengthening: visiting homes where poverty is indicated as a reason for a boy living on the street and supporting families through accessing health care, starting micro-enterprise, enabling self-sufficiency through food growing, etc.

Residential Provision: for boys under 15 who cannot go home for circumstances such as abuse or having no family.

Vocational Training: for boys in residential provision and education.

Future Plans:

All of the current activities for boys over 15.
